Portrait of the Danish scientist Hans Christian Ørsted (1777–1851). 1840s. Signed Em. Btz. Pencil, white and wash on paper. Sheet size 25×19 cm. Unframed. This drawing is the original drawing for a lithograph in “Dansk Pantheon. Et Portraitgalleri for Samtiden”, 1842–51, published by Em. Bærentzen & Comp.'s Lithographic Institute. The Danish physicist and chemist Hans Christian Ørsted was one of the central figures of the Danish Golden Age. He is generally credited with the discovery of electromagnetism.
